One problem in developing a parallel program is monitoring its behavior for debugging and performance tuning. This paper discusses an enhanced tracing facility and tool for PVM (Parallel Virtual Machine), a message passing library for parallel processing in a heterogeneous environment. PVM supports mixed collections of workstation clusters, shared-memory multiprocessors, and massively parallel processors. The upcoming release of PVM, Version 3.4, contains a new, improved tracing facility which provides flexible, efficient access to run-time program information. This new tracing system supports a buffering mechanism to reduce perturbation of user applications caused by tracing, and a more flexible trace event definition scheme based on a sel...
Fay is a flexible platform for the efficient collection, processing, and analysis of software execut...
One of the important phases of parallel programming is performance analysis. Trace data provides inf...
A common debugging strategy involves re-executing a program (on a given input) over and over, each t...
One of the more bothersome aspects of developing a parallel program is that of monitoring the behavi...
This report describes a trace and replay tool for PVM (Parallel Virtual Machine) message passing app...
Debugging is generally considered to be difficult. The increased complexity and non determinism of p...
XPVM-W95 2.0, a novel monitoring tool for parallel applications that employ PVM-W95 (PVM for Windows...
The dynamic behavior of parallel programs can be disclosed by event-driven monitoring. A hybrid moni...
Introduction The PVMVis visualisation tool is one of the three tools of the EDPEPPS project. The is...
The PVM system -- which is one of the most popular message-passing interface currently -- represents...
This article presents mEDA-2, an extension to PVM which provides Virtual Shared Memory, VSM, for int...
Event tracing of applications under dynamic execution is crucial for performance modeling, optimizat...
Abstract. Performance analysis tools are an important component of the parallel program development ...
Performance analysis tools are an important component of the parallel program development and tuning...
Parallel Virtual Machine (PVM) is a widely-used software system that allows a heterogeneous set of p...
Fay is a flexible platform for the efficient collection, processing, and analysis of software execut...
One of the important phases of parallel programming is performance analysis. Trace data provides inf...
A common debugging strategy involves re-executing a program (on a given input) over and over, each t...
One of the more bothersome aspects of developing a parallel program is that of monitoring the behavi...
This report describes a trace and replay tool for PVM (Parallel Virtual Machine) message passing app...
Debugging is generally considered to be difficult. The increased complexity and non determinism of p...
XPVM-W95 2.0, a novel monitoring tool for parallel applications that employ PVM-W95 (PVM for Windows...
The dynamic behavior of parallel programs can be disclosed by event-driven monitoring. A hybrid moni...
Introduction The PVMVis visualisation tool is one of the three tools of the EDPEPPS project. The is...
The PVM system -- which is one of the most popular message-passing interface currently -- represents...
This article presents mEDA-2, an extension to PVM which provides Virtual Shared Memory, VSM, for int...
Event tracing of applications under dynamic execution is crucial for performance modeling, optimizat...
Abstract. Performance analysis tools are an important component of the parallel program development ...
Performance analysis tools are an important component of the parallel program development and tuning...
Parallel Virtual Machine (PVM) is a widely-used software system that allows a heterogeneous set of p...
Fay is a flexible platform for the efficient collection, processing, and analysis of software execut...
One of the important phases of parallel programming is performance analysis. Trace data provides inf...
A common debugging strategy involves re-executing a program (on a given input) over and over, each t...